Great and nostalgic! Advices for some negative reviews:
I've had this Tamagotchi for 2 weeks and I managed to raise him to the Adult stage.Before purchasing, I read reviews where some Tamagotchis would die after 3/4 days with good care, others said the egg wouldn't hatch.1. My first tama died after 3 days with perfect care. I realized you have to be very careful with the weight after the baby stage. Each stage has a base weight (baby 5 oz; child 10 oz; teen 20 oz; adult 30 oz) and if you double his base weight he will get sick and die. Mine was a child with 22 oz when he died... After keeping track of his weight, I managed to keep him alive until Adult stage (currently 13yr).2. I would recommend reseting your Tamagotchi after you first turn it on. Also, the egg will only hatch if you set the time. Which means, every time you reset it you need to set the time again.Overall I'm very happy with the product. Unfortunately my first tamagotchi died at only 3 years old. That's 3 days in real life time. 1 day of real life time is 1 year in tamagotchi time. I have since started a new tamagotchi and I'm hoping it lives longer this time. Some advice for you if your tamagotchi keeps dying at a young age for no reason. If you give your tamagotchi snacks especially when it's a baby it usually won't live past 3. I didn't find this out until I was on my 3rd tamagotchi. I asked on the tamagotchi Reddit why my tamagotchis kept dying and several people on there said if you give it snacks especially when it's a baby which is what I did it won't usually live past 3 and if it does it won't live much past that age. I haven't given my current tamagotchi and snacks at all and it has so far lived much longer than my other ones. It is currently 7 at the time of this review and is my first tamagotchi to reach the adult stage..
